“You win some, you loose some...”
2 of 5 stars Reviewed 13 May 2011

Well what can I say...the Oakwood Guesthouse was very dissapointing.

After paying extra for secure parking I arrived and drove my car around to the back of the guesthouse where the parking is located. The area has insufficient spaces as the carpark has lock up garages down one side and a portacabin down the other. Thes "secure" area is fenced off with what can best be described as a tempory barrier grids like you might find around a building site held shut with a padlock on some chain.

After sorting the car out I entered the building via the back entrance down a dingy corridoor and to the locked up office area. Nobody too be found...

Decided to leave it for an hour and walked around the delapedated area that is West Drayton. Upon returning the owner had turned up so got shown up some dingy stairs to an even more dingy room. Think young offenders institute turned into a b&b with minimal changes made. The walls were stained and scuffed and I had only a small frosted glass window high up in one corner of the room for natural light. My room had an adjoining door with the next and I could hear everything the guy was doing and saying the whole time. The only saving grace was the bed which thankfully was clean and comfortable.

The bathroom smelt like strong bleach and the one piece drop forged stainless steel sink/worktop/wall was ugly and cheap. The shower head wouldn't spray the water but instead let it gush out like a tap, thankfully it was hot.

I passed on the breakfast as I had no confidence in the cleanliness.

As you have probably gathered overall I was not impressed with the Oakwood Guesthouse and I would not recommend it to anybody. The room was overpriced and West Drayton is a dump, steer clear..

“Great place to stay inexpensively near Heathrow”
5 of 5 stars Reviewed 5 May 2010

We stayed at the Oakwood for 3 nights waiting for flights to resume out of Heathrow. The staff were extremely personable and helpful. They were forthcoming on information about getting around without paying an arm and a leg: taking local taxis to Heathrow (7 GBP), taking the train into town (5-min. walk then 25 min to Paddington), they had guide books, advice etc. The location is very handy; it's next to a business district with grocery stores, pharmacy, PO, restaurants, etc.; a real community. We were happy not to be held hostage to airport services and inflated prices. We had an "premium twin ensuite" with a trundle bed for our son, who unfortunately was sick and didn't see much more than the inside of the room, but he was satisfied, and so were his parents. Given that hotel rooms in London are notoriously small, we were very satisfied with the size of this one, and the bathroom and shower were great. Wireless internet is available for a fee - this was great as I was checking flights a lot and could do e-mail, though the connection speed was irregular. Breakfast was hearty. It felt like home. We would definitely stay there again.
